Shah Rukh Khan to head to US for an emergency eye surgery: Reports

Shah Rukh Khan is reportedly heading to the US for eye treatment. King Khan, who was last seen in Rajkumar Hirani's Dunki, went for an eye checkup at a Mumbai hospital on Monday. According to a report, Khan was to undergo surgery on Monday, however, the treatment did not go according to plan.

According to Bollywood Hungama, the actor is now headed to the US. “SRK is now being rushed to the USA to rectify the damage. It is expected that the superstar will fly to the foreign country either today or tomorrow, that is, Tuesday, July 30."

Shah Rukh's manager, Pooja Dadlani, has not confirmed the news yet.

Khan was hospitalised in Ahmedabad, Gujarat, a few months back after suffering heat stroke and dehydration. The actor was in the city to cheer for his team KKRduring the IPL tournament.

In 2014, Shah Rukh underwent minor eye surgery to correct his vision. Post-surgery, he took to his X to thank the doctor and wrote, "A big thank you to Dr.Burjor Banaji & his lovely wife for doing my surgery. It's so good, that now I can read even between the lines."

Meanwhile, on the work front, Shah Rukh Khan has reportedly started working on Sujoy Ghosh's next King which will co-star Suhana Khan and Abhishek Bachchan. SRK has so far not made any official announcement about the project.
